The LT3020IDD#PBF is a 100 mA very low dropout linear voltage regulator from Analog Devices, featuring a maximum dropout voltage of only 285 mV at full load across the -40°C to +125°C industrial temperature range. It operates with input voltages as low as 1 V and is housed in an 8-pin DFN package for compact low-power designs. Designed for powering noise-sensitive analog and RF circuits in portable, battery-powered, and wearable applications.

Key Features

  • Ultra-low dropout voltage of 285 mV maximum at 100 mA enabling efficient regulation from thin-battery or near-depleted cell supplies
  • Wide input voltage range starting from 1 V supporting sub-1.5 V battery-powered and energy-harvesting circuit designs
  • 100 mA output current with low quiescent current for extended battery runtime in IoT and wearable devices
  • Industrial temperature range of -40°C to +125°C ensuring reliable operation in harsh field environments
  • Compact 8-pin DFN package with small footprint enabling dense PCB layouts in handheld and wearable electronics

Applications

The LT3020IDD#PBF is used as a post-regulator on switching power supply outputs to eliminate switching noise on sensitive analog, RF, and sensor supply rails in portable medical devices, wearable fitness trackers, and IoT sensor nodes. Its ultra-low 285 mV dropout allows it to regulate down to near-depleted lithium-ion cell voltages, maximizing usable battery energy in single-cell 3.7 V powered products. The device also serves as a precision low-noise supply for op-amp reference voltages, RF front-end modules, and MEMS sensor power inputs in designs requiring sub-10 µV/√Hz supply noise performance.

Frequently Asked Questions

What is the dropout voltage of the LT3020IDD#PBF, and why does it matter for battery-powered designs?

The LT3020IDD#PBF has a maximum dropout voltage of 285 mV at 100 mA output current. For a single-cell lithium-ion battery discharging from 4.2 V down to 3.0 V, this low dropout allows the regulator to maintain a 3.0 V output rail until the battery voltage drops to 3.285 V, extracting approximately 30% more battery capacity compared to a standard LDO with 1 V dropout before the output falls out of regulation.

For RF front-end or sensor supply filtering, what noise performance does the LT3020IDD#PBF provide?

The LT3020IDD#PBF provides very low output noise, typically below 30 µV RMS in the 10 Hz to 100 kHz bandwidth, which is critical for powering RF oscillators, VCOs, and precision ADC reference pins where supply noise directly adds phase noise or degrades SNR. Using the LT3020IDD#PBF as a post-regulator after a 5 V switching supply can reduce supply noise by 40 dB or more, achieving sub-10 µV/√Hz spectral noise density at 1 kHz for sensitive analog front ends.

How does the LT3020IDD#PBF's 8-pin DFN package compare in size to TO-92 or SOT-23 LDO alternatives?

The 8-pin DFN package measures approximately 3 mm x 3 mm with 0.65 mm pin pitch and an exposed bottom pad, which is comparable in footprint to an SOT-23-5 package at 2.9 mm x 1.6 mm but offers better thermal dissipation through the ground pad. Compared to a TO-92 through-hole LDO occupying a 5 mm x 5 mm PCB keep-out area, the LT3020IDD#PBF's DFN package reduces board area by over 70%, enabling higher component density in wearable device PCBs where space is measured in square millimeters.

When is LT3020IDD#PBF a better choice than a switching regulator for powering a sensor or ADC?

The LT3020IDD#PBF is preferred over a switching regulator when the load current is below 100 mA and supply noise must remain below 50 µV RMS, because switching regulators generate 10 mV to 100 mV of ripple at switching frequencies of 1 MHz to 4 MHz that requires multiple LC filter stages to attenuate. The LDO's inherent low-pass characteristic achieves 60 dB rejection of input supply noise above 1 kHz with no external filter components, simplifying BOM and reducing design time for noise-sensitive pressure sensors, temperature measurement ICs, and precision reference circuits.
